An LLC offers liability protection for your personal assets while also providing tax benefits. One of the primary taxation considerations for a single member LLC is that it’s considered a pass-through entity. This means that the profits and losses of the LLC will be reported on the owner’s personal tax return rather than the business itself being taxed separately.

Additionally, as an LLC owner, you have the flexibility to choose how you want to be taxed – either as a sole proprietorship or as an S corporation. By doing so, you can potentially save money on self-employment taxes and overall tax liability.

Overall, forming a single member LLC can provide significant advantages for small business owners looking for liability protection and taxation benefits.

Choosing The Right Business Name

Understanding the benefits of a single member LLC is crucial before proceeding with the formation process. Now that you have a clear understanding of what an LLC is and how it can benefit your business, it’s time to choose the right business name.

Your business name should be memorable, easy to spell, and represent your brand. It’s important to note that the state of Alaska has specific requirements for naming your LLC. For example, your business name must include the words ‘Limited Liability Company’ or any abbreviations such as ‘LLC.’

Brainstorming techniques can help you come up with a unique and fitting name for your LLC. Consider using descriptive words related to your industry or personal interests and try to avoid names that are too similar to existing businesses in Alaska.

Legal considerations are also essential when choosing a business name. You should conduct a thorough search of the Alaska Business Name Database to ensure that your desired name is available and not already in use by another company. Additionally, trademarks and domain names should also be checked for availability before finalizing your LLC’s name.

Once you’ve chosen a name that meets all legal requirements and accurately represents your brand, you can move forward with registering it as an official business name in Alaska. Remember that this is an essential step in forming a single member LLC, so take the time to choose wisely!

Filing Your Articles Of Organization

Filing Your Articles of Organization is a crucial step in starting your single member LLC in Alaska. To ensure that your business is properly registered and recognized by the state, you must comply with the filing requirements set forth by the Alaska Division of Corporations, Business and Professional Licensing. These requirements include submitting a completed Articles of Organization form and paying the corresponding filing fee.

Before submitting your Articles of Organization, it’s important to consider some legal considerations that may affect your LLC. For instance, you’ll need to choose a unique name for your business that complies with Alaska’s naming requirements.

You’ll also need to designate a registered agent who will serve as your LLC’s point of contact with the state, receive legal documents on behalf of your business, and help ensure compliance with state regulations.

Additionally, you may want to consider drafting an operating agreement to outline how your LLC will be managed and operated. Taking these steps can help protect your business from liability and ensure that it operates smoothly moving forward.

Obtaining Necessary Licenses And Permits

After filing your Articles of Organization, you can now focus on the next important step in starting your single member LLC in Alaska. This involves obtaining necessary licenses and permits to ensure regulatory compliance and establish the right business structure for your operations.

To begin with, it’s essential to know which licenses and permits are required for your specific industry or type of business. The state of Alaska has an online business license checklist that you can use as a guide. It’s important to note that some professions, such as healthcare providers, require additional licenses and certifications from specialized boards or agencies.

Once you have identified the necessary licenses and permits, you can apply for them through the State of Alaska Business Licensing Center or the municipality where your business will be located. Keep in mind that some municipalities may have additional requirements or fees.

Ensuring regulatory compliance is crucial to avoid penalties, fines, or even legal action against your LLC. As a single member LLC owner, it’s your responsibility to stay up-to-date with local and state regulations that apply to your industry. Consider consulting with a lawyer or accountant who specializes in small businesses to help you navigate complex regulatory requirements.

By obtaining necessary licenses and permits, you’re not only complying with the law but also establishing a solid foundation for your startup’s success.
